Karrion Kross and Scarlett Set for First Match After WWE Exit

The post-WWE journey of Karrion Kross and Scarlett Bordeaux is already taking shape. The duo, whose contracts officially expired earlier this month, have been confirmed for their first in-ring appearance since leaving the company.
Independent promotion WrestlePro announced that Kross will wrestle at their upcoming event on Saturday, September 21st, with Scarlett also appearing alongside him. While an opponent has not yet been revealed, the announcement marks the first time fans will see the pair in a wrestling environment since their WWE departure.

Last WWE Bout Came at SummerSlam
Kross’ final WWE match took place at SummerSlam on August 2, where he squared off with Sami Zayn. Just days later, on August 10, both Kross and Scarlett’s contracts officially expired. The pair were quietly moved to WWE’s alumni section online, seemingly putting to rest speculation about possible new deals.
Their exit became even clearer after Kross addressed the situation publicly, including a candid interview with Ariel Helwani, where he spoke openly about the end of his WWE run and his uncertain future.
